E minor six diminished scale — chords and intervals

The E minor six diminished scale is a sophisticated jazz scale popularized by the Barry Harris method. On guitar, its notes are E, F#, G, A, B, C, C#, D#. It is the secret to professional voice leading in bebop, allowing for smooth, elegant movements between minor chords and their related tensions. The E minor six diminished scale has the following degrees: 1 2 ♭3 4 5 ♭6 6 7.

Intervals: W-H-W-W-H-H-W-H.
